On common, residence costs had been overvalued by 11.1% throughout the nation, rising from 9.4% three months earlier. Over 91% of metropolitan areas within the U.S. might be thought-about overvalued on the finish of September, up from 88% within the second quarter, Fitch’s sustainable residence worth report stated.
Rising property values are the first issue leading to any unsustainable tempo of development, as different financial indicators confirmed higher stability.

Among the many complete set of overvalued markets, 58% exceeded Fitch’s benchmark by 10% or extra.
Winston-Salem, North Carolina; Memphis, Tennessee, and McAllen, Texas, had been deemed essentially the most overvalued metropolitan areas within the nation. Narrowed to the 50 largest cities, Memphis topped the checklist, adopted by Buffalo, New York; Milwaukee and Indianapolis, all of which had been overvalued by not less than 20%.
On the opposite finish, Fitch discovered solely six cities with sustainable worth will increase: Cleveland, Denver, Los Angeles, Dallas-Fort Price, Miami and Detroit.
Measuring residence costs by state, South Carolina, the place values grew 6.6%, was the lone jurisdiction overvalued by greater than 20%. Colorado, North Dakota, Michigan and Louisiana had been thought-about sustainable.
Fitch forecasts residence worth appreciation to sluggish nationally to beneath 3% this 12 months, after rising 5.5% by the tip of 2023. “This forecast relies on the interaction between a number of elements, reminiscent of affordability challenges and a good provide of houses, with the latter the extra dominant consider sustaining constructive residence worth development,” the report stated.
